"I haven't seen the photos, but I know that he has hand warmers in his pocket," said Finch after the game.
"He has them every single game he plays. I honestly haven't seen them, so I can't comment too much on it. But I know for a fact that he has hand warmers every game."
https://twitter.com/Swannyg66/status/1138011116636950528?s=20 The incident comes more than a year after Cameron Bancroft received a nine-month ban by Cricket Australia for rubbing sandpaper against a ball during a Test match against South Africa. Steve Smith and David Warner, both of whom admitted to overseeing the ball tampering, received one-year bans for their part in the controversy.
